1. Collection of http protocol data

Each time a user accesses the DPG-GmbH website, data about this process is stored and processed in a log file. In detail, the following data is stored about each access: Anonymized IP address, date and time of access, browser type and version, operating system, URL and previously visited website.
The temporary storage of the IP address by the system is necessary to enable delivery of the website to the user's computer. For this purpose, the user's IP address must remain stored for the duration of the session. The storage in log files is done to ensure the functionality of the website. In addition, we use the data for statistical evaluations and to improve the offer for our customers and third parties interested in DPG-GmbH, as well as to ensure the security of our information technology systems. An evaluation of the data for marketing purposes does not take place in this context, nor does the storage of this data together with other personal data of the user. Prior to storage beyond one session, each data record is anonymized by changing the IP address. It is therefore not possible to assign the collected data to a specific natural person.

The legal basis for the temporary storage of the data and the log files is Art. 6 para. 1 lit. f DSGVO. The processing serves to protect a legitimate interest of our company or a third party. This interest does not outweigh the interests, fundamental rights and freedoms of the data subject. By anonymizing the IP address, the interest of the users in their protection of personal data is sufficiently taken into account, so that a permanent storage of the anonymized data is possible.

7. Your Data Subject Rights

You can exercise the following rights in accordance with the GDPR at any time using the contact details provided for our data protection officer:

  • Information about your data stored by us and its processing,
  • Correction of incorrect personal data,
  • Deletion of your data stored by us, unless we are required to retain your data due to statutory retention obligations and periods,
  • Restriction of data processing, provided that we are not yet allowed to delete your data due to legal obligations, objection to the processing of your data by us and
  • Data portability, provided that you have consented to the data processing or have concluded a contract with us.

If you have given us consent, you can revoke this at any time with effect for the future.

You can contact the supervisory authority responsible for you at any time with a complaint. Your competent supervisory authority depends on the federal state of your registered office or the alleged violation.
